In MPEG Layer III coding the compression gain is mainly achieved through the unequal distribution of energy in the different frequency bands, the use of the psychoacoustic model, and Huffman coding.
A statistical compression method that converts characters into variable length bit strings. Most-frequently occurring characters are converted to shortest bit strings; least frequent, the longest.
